    After playing with EVERYTHING at the musikmesse, (i checked out the bcd2000, the codanova, the mawzer, the kontrol:dj, the ecler nuo-4 & nuo-5's and even the xone:3d), i can honestly say this....

    I am be no means a professional dj, in which case the BCD is the absolute perfect product in terms of what it can do and its low price...vs things like the codanova, mawzer, kontrol dj.

    The Ecler's are a beautiful mixer in my opinion, without considering the customisable midi stuff. With that, they are really incredible.

    I've been scouring around for a cheap nuo-4 or nuo-5, ever since i first played with one. But of course you are still looking at at least €700 minimum for a second hand one. I ordered my BCD back in may last year, and totally forgot that i had ordered until it arrived yesterday. In that time since june, i settled on getting a nuo, but i'm more than happy to have the BCD as well.

    It comes down a question of cost.

    low end: Behringer bcd2000
    mid range: Ecler nuo4 or 5 (there are some other options)
    high end: Xone:3d

    Rocdollar - think it is down to the 2 deck thing - everything layed out exactly alike mixing decks, with additional controls an dthe crossfader right in the middle, where it lives. The Bitstream to me looks, well, Ableton-ish. I've also got the BCR2000 and the BCF2000 and have absolutely no quarms or issues with them at all, work perfectly for my needs, will be using either with the BCD2000 once it comes out, so I'll have bare nuff control. Looking forward to actually owning one now - glad i've ewaited so far, have been searching for alternatives, but nothing really compares. Even after getting touchy-feely with a BCD2000 at the SoundExpo last month, the controls all feel great, nice pitch control like a deck should be (not exactly Technic 1210 pitch-control, but not a loose MIDI fader that flies all over the place). Goonna have to get used to being left handed with the pitch control (the whole console is mirrored), but hey, if I'm up for sitting thru 80hours of Dnb sampling, I'm definately up for smashing up the sound systems with me lappy and Traktor as soon as I can!!
